Blazin' Hot Margarita

This refreshing Blazin' Hot Margarita is perfect for a hot summer day or as part of your weekend BBQ!
Prep Time20 minutes
Total Time20 minutes
Course: Drinks
Servings: 2

Ingredients

  • 4 oz blanco tequila
  • 2 oz fresh lime juice
  • 2 oz simple syrup
  • 1 jalapeño sliced with seeds
  • chili lime salt/tajin for rim
  • ice

Instructions

  • Soak 1/2 sliced jalapeño with seeds in 4 oz tequila for 15-30 minutes prior to making (amount can be adjusted to however many drinks you are making)
  • Dip the rim of your glasses in lime juice or water and then in the chili lime salt/tajin and fill glasses with ice
  • Pour ice, lime juice, simple syrup, tequila and jalapeño mixture into a shaker cup
  • Shake vigorously for about 30 seconds or until you feel the shaker get really cold
  • Strain drink into glasses, garnish with remaining jalapeño slices and lime wedge and serve!

Notes

  • You can increase or decrease the amount of simple syrup depending on your sweetness preferences
  • This recipe can be easily halved, doubled or tripled based on how many margarita's you are making
  • It is important to make sure you use the seeds of the jalapeño when making this or it won't get spicy enough
  • If you don't have simple syrup, you can easily make it at home by boiling a 1:1 ratio of sugar and water until it turns into a syrupy consistency
